Weekend Seminars
IDS offered a number of seminars for design professionals and enthusiasts on Saturday, January 26, 2013.
Admission was priced at $35 + HST for each seminar. General admission to the show floor was included in the seminar price.

The Art of Collection Presented by Ago
Speakers: Elizabeth Petrova, Alex D'Arcy & Harriet Goodman
Room 201D

The art of collecting can be exciting and rewarding, but also a little intimidating. As such, the Art Gallery of Ontario’s Art Rental + Sales Gallery offers a talk as a tool for novice and established collectors who wish to gain valuable tips for starting and enhancing a collection. Join us for a crash course in building corporate and private art collections. We will provide advice on choosing artwork for decor, share strategies for building collections, and discuss using artwork for investment. The AGO Art Rental + Sales Gallery is a valuable resource for both your home and office. Our free consulting services and eclectic collection of Canadian contemporary art from commercial galleries and independent artists is unique in Toronto. This is a one-stop-shop for anyone looking for art. Not only do we offer both rental and sales, we’re there to help you select art and make it easy to transport and install. AGO’s Art Rental and Sales consultants offer free consultations and site visits and will provide advice on choosing and hanging artwork in ways that will inspire you daily and keep the accountant in you happy for having made a wise investment.
High Low Design - How to get the Most out of any Renovation Project presented by National Bank
Speaker: Jill Greaves
Room 201D

With a breadth of experience in designing home interiors, Jill Greaves Design will present the top five items to consider before any embarking upon any renovation project. Touching upon budgeting, space planning, and value for the future, Jill Greaves will discuss elements to consider for every room of the house. She will draw on practical examples of stylish interiors from her own portfolio and beyond and discuss where to spend and cut costs for large scale homes and small space condos alike. Considering the growing number of multifunctional homes, Jill will also weigh in on the special needs of live/work spaces and home office renovations.
